G'day all,

Just after some opinions from people that have used both SayIntentions and BeyondATC.

I've currently got SayIntentions and think it's pretty bloody good, but it's costing me around $40 a month and if I'm honest I barely use MSFS these days compared to when I first signed up.

I'm looking at BeyondATC mostly because it seems a lot cheaper long term, but I don't really know enough about either platform to work out whether I'd be making a mistake switching over.

For someone who only jumps on the sim every now and then these days, is SayIntentions actually worth the extra money or is BeyondATC good enough that I probably won't care?

Keen to hear from people who've used both because all the YouTube reviews seem to tell me everything is amazing and none of them are spending their own money.

u/i82bugs IRL MIL CFI CPL Jun 02 '26

BATC will suit you just fine. You may notice a bit less flavor and it may be a little more on rails, but at least it works reliably. SI makes a wonderful first impression and does a great job at pretending to be more elaborate until it absolutely crashes out in the worst AI slop way.

u/isemonger Stuck at 97%... Jun 04 '26

Man I ended up giving BATC a go, and honestly it’s night and day. The integration of SI is so much cleaner, along with the traffic injection. It just feels a lot more polished, and as it bloody should at a subscription rate.

I fully see what you’re on about the rails, but I honestly don’t think I’ve yet see SI go off on tangents or even crash yet?

I even leave SI on in the background on career just for the traffic and chatter, and it’s pretty useful to help me learn taxiways and lingo for my CPL. I’m not writing BATC off yet, but my first couple hours weren’t really immersive.

u/i82bugs IRL MIL CFI CPL Jun 04 '26

Oh yeah, SI is definitely more immersive, no argument there, and that's what I meant about first impressions. Speech recognition/accuracy and basic functionality are better through BATC IMO. SI may no longer accept a cake recipe for a readback, but it also won't reliably correct you. That's in addition to regularly hallucinating runways and approaches, actively encouraging CFIT, and vectoring 30 mile base turns. Traffic at my local field uses  the opposite of its stated runway and the procedural deviations make me roll my eyes. 

I have a lot of time with SI, and my experience with it is that it gets worse the more that you use it. My goals with it may also be different from yours. All that to say, I am sorry if I helped to steer you wrong. Good luck on your CPL.
